AG unable to present charges against Easter attack perpetrators as CID probes incomplete

(UTV | COLOMBO) – Attorney General (AG) Dappula de Livera has informed the public that he is unable to present indictments against the conspirators and abettors of the Easter attacks within his tenure as the Criminal Investigation Department (CID)’s probes are incomplete.

Dappula de Livera’s term in Office as the AG is due to conclude this month. He was sworn in on 10 May, 2019 before then-President Maithripala Sirisena.
